I want to instal 7 Newpowa 220W Monocrystalline 10BB Cell Solar Panels in series. The challenge I have is there can be NO roof penetrations. I can only mount the rackinging into the top of the South ledge and the side of the North ledge. Any ideas hoe I could do this with unistrut?

That's going to be a challenge.

I'd recommend taking out one of the screws from that edge of the aluminium sheet cover and poking a bit through diagonally around the plastic insert inside. it's highly likely the edge covers are directly screwed into the concrete wall if the building structure was built using that material. If it's concrete, that should be a proper anchor point for at least one side of the panel holder. Just use the roof screws with a washer that has a rubber sealant.
